Re: does constant cooking fragment your HDD faster?

Quote:
Originally Posted by MadlyAlive View Post
I've never used M$'s built in defrag. I love Diskeeper.
The biult in deftrag is just a stripped down version of Diskeeper Defragmenter. You can even automate it with the Windows Task Scheduler. If you leave your computer on 24/7, just set it to run at 0300, (or other time when you are not using your computer). You can also set Disk Cleaner to run automatically by entering the command "cleanmgr /sageset:40" in your run box, selecting all the options you wish to automate, and pressing OK. To set up the automation, use WTS, and use the command "cleanmgr /sagerun:40" approximatly 1 hour before disk defrag is scheduled to run.
